Aller au contenu

OpenCode

OpenCode expose deux catalogues hébergés dans OpenClaw :

CataloguePréfixeProvider d’exécution
Zenopencode/...opencode
Goopencode-go/...opencode-go

Les deux catalogues utilisent la même clé API OpenCode. OpenClaw conserve les ids des providers d’exécution séparés afin que le routage amont par modèle reste correct, mais l’onboarding et la documentation les traitent comme une configuration OpenCode unique.

Idéal pour : le proxy multi-modèles OpenCode sélectionné (Claude, GPT, Gemini).

  1. Exécuter l'onboarding

    Fenêtre de terminal
    openclaw onboard --auth-choice opencode-zen

    Ou passez la clé directement :

    Fenêtre de terminal
    openclaw onboard --opencode-zen-api-key "$OPENCODE_API_KEY"
  2. Définir un modèle Zen par défaut

    Fenêtre de terminal
    openclaw config set agents.defaults.model.primary "opencode/claude-opus-4-6"
  3. Vérifier que les modèles sont disponibles

    Fenêtre de terminal
    openclaw models list --provider opencode
{
env: { OPENCODE_API_KEY: "sk-..." },
agents: { defaults: { model: { primary: "opencode/claude-opus-4-6" } } },
}
PropriétéValeur
Provider d’exécutionopencode
Modèles exemplesopencode/claude-opus-4-6, opencode/gpt-5.5, opencode/gemini-3-pro
PropriétéValeur
Provider d’exécutionopencode-go
Modèles exemplesopencode-go/kimi-k2.6, opencode-go/glm-5, opencode-go/minimax-m2.5
Alias de clé API

OPENCODE_ZEN_API_KEY est également pris en charge comme un alias pour OPENCODE_API_KEY.

Identifiants partagés

Saisir une clé OpenCode lors de la configuration stocke les identifiants pour les deux fournisseurs d’exécution. Vous n’avez pas besoin de configurer chaque catalogue séparément.

Facturation et tableau de bord

Vous vous connectez à OpenCode, ajoutez les détails de facturation et copiez votre clé API. La facturation et la disponibilité des catalogues sont gérées à partir du tableau de bord OpenCode.

Comportement de relecture Gemini

Les références OpenCode basées sur Gemini restent sur le chemin proxy-Gemini, donc OpenClaw conserve le nettoyage de la signature de pensée Gemini sans activer la validation native de relecture Gemini ou les réécritures d’amorçage.

Comportement de relecture non-Gemini

Les références OpenCode non-Gemini conservent la stratégie de relecture minimale compatible OpenAI.

Sélection de modèle

Choisir les fournisseurs, les références de modèle et le comportement de basculement.

Référence de configuration

Référence complète de la configuration pour les agents, les modèles et les fournisseurs.